Transportation Partners Rally Logistics Industry in Support of Habitat for Humanity of Puerto Rico

Transportation Partners Rally Logistics Industry in Support of Habitat for Humanity of Puerto Rico
1 May 2023

Trailer Bridge, Inc. and ATS International today announced their Rally por Puerto Rico Charity Golf Tournament raised more than $104,500 for Habitat for Humanity of Puerto Rico supporting the organization’s efforts to create and preserve home ownership opportunities for low-income individuals and families on the island.

Both Trailer Bridge and ATS have supported the island’s supply chain needs for more than 30 years and say the event is an extension of their commitment to serving the people of Puerto Rico. Habitat will use the funds to support its mission including construction and rehabilitation projects for new homeowners on the island. The average cost of a single-family dwelling is nearly $180,000 due to the increase in building materials and labor shortages.

“I am so grateful for all those who came out to support this year’s Rally tournament as well as our ongoing relationship with ATS to host this event,” said Trailer Bridge CEO Mitch Luciano. “Now more than ever community organizations like Habitat Puerto Rico need our support as they – like all of us – face the rising costs of goods. This donation will allow them to continue the important work they do to serve families on the island – one of which we had the privilege of meeting today.”

The Rally por Puerto Rico Charity Golf Tournament began in 2019 with the goal of bringing together local transportation and logistics leaders committed to serving the people of Puerto Rico. Trailer Bridge and ATS cover all expenses related to the event so that 100% of the sponsorship dollars go directly to Habitat for Humanity of Puerto Rico. This year nearly 90 golfers joined together at Bahia Beach Resort and Golf Club for the tournament. Since 2019, the event has raised nearly $300,000 for the organization.

Volunteers from both Trailer Bridge and ATS recently spent a day working on a rehabilitation project in the municipality of Guayama, Puerto Rico. The project was part of Habitat’s Puerto Rico Home Acquisition Program where the organization works to build or rehabilitate single or multifamily homes. Together with Habitat Puerto Rico staff and three families, TB and ATS volunteers worked to complete various tasks including cleaning of the interior of the home, exterior work on the landscape as well as the demolition of a cement structure.

Trailer Bridge operates two roll-on, roll-off barges that deliver goods to the island including building materials used to develop homes for local families. The company has been serving the island since 1991 and signed long-term lease agreements with the Puerto Rico Ports Authority and the Jacksonville Port Authority within the past two years anchoring its commitment to the island for more than 20 years.

About Habitat for Humanity of Puerto Rico

Habitat for Humanity of Puerto Rico, is a non-profit organization with a history of 25 years on the island, being the local affiliate of the global entity Habitat for Humanity International, with a presence in the 50 states of the United States and over 70 countries. Founded in Puerto Rico in 1997, the organization works to help families and individuals achieve stability, self-sufficiency, and the opportunity to have a better future through affordable housing and capacity projects, with the collaboration of donors and volunteers. About Trailer Bridge

Trailer Bridge is an asset-light, full-service transportation provider headquartered in Jacksonville, Florida with offices throughout North America and in the Caribbean. The company was founded in 1991 by industry-pioneer Malcom McLean to serve the Puerto Rico trade lane and has since expanded to provide domestic transportation solutions and international freight shipping services to shippers around the globe. In addition, Trailer Bridge has a division dedicated to supporting the needs of government freight. About ATS International

ATS International is a wholly owned subsidiary of Anderson Trucking Service, Inc. (ATS). Founded in 1955 and headquartered in St. Cloud, MN – ATS is a recognized leader in flatbed, specialized, logistics, van, and international transportation. With offices located throughout the United States, ATS is the largest asset-based truckload carrier in Minnesota, and the 30th largest for-hire carrier in North America, operating more than 2,700 tractors and 8,600 trailers. ATS International extends that service coverage, providing global service through both operated international offices and well-established agent partners.
